Why Creative Partnerships Need a Different Approach
Creative work is deeply personal. Identity, vulnerability, passion, ego, and emotional expression are often intertwined with the work itself.
When conflict arises, it is rarely just about the project, it is often connected to unmet needs, communication styles, attachment patterns, emotional triggers, and relational dynamics beneath the surface.
Theracoaching helps uncover and address those deeper dynamics while creating practical tools for healthier collaboration and communication.
